When manually forwarding an email in Gmail, there is a lot more that can be done other than just adding a recipient and your response.

Here are five overlooked email forwarding features in Gmail that you should know about.
1 – How To Reply To Original Sender Of Forwarded Message Gmail
In Gmail, you can reply to the original sender of a forwarded email by replacing the email address in the email recipients field with the original sender’s email address when replying to the forwarded email.
This can be achieved by using the following steps:
1 – Locate the forwarded email you would like to reply to and open it.
2 – Click the reply button icon at the top right of the email.

2b – Alternatively, you can click on the reply button at the bottom of the email.

3 – At the top of the reply window, click on the email address of the forwarder and delete it by clicking on the “x” to the right of the email address.

4 – Copy the original sender’s email address from the email header of the forwarded email.

5 – In the empty email recipients field enter or paste in the original sender’s email address.

6 – Finally, in the reply window type out your message response then click on the Send button.

2 – How To Change Subject Line In Gmail When Forwarding
In Gmail, you can change the subject line of any email that you would like to forward by using the built-in edit subject feature.
1 – Open the email that you would like to forward.
2 – Click on the three vertical dots to the right of the email then select the forward option in the menu.

3 – Within the email forwarding window, click on the type of response button to the left of the email recipients field.

4 – In the dropdown menu select the edit subject option. This will pop out the reply window and reveal the subject field.

5 – Erase the current subject of the email and change it to the one you desire.

6 – Enter the email address of the person you’re forwarding the email to and then click send.

3 – How To Edit Forwarded Email In Gmail
To edit a forwarded email in Gmail you will first need to click on the forward button and then in the reply window scroll past the forwarding header to view and make changes to the original or previous conversations located in that email thread.
1 – Open the email you want to forward.
2 – Scroll down to the end of the email and click on the forward button.

2 – Within the email forwarding window, scroll down past the forwarding header to view the original email and past conversations.

3 – Make any necessary changes to the content of the original email.
4 – Enter the email address of the persons that you’re forwarding the edited email and click send.
4 – How To Remove Attachments In Gmail When Forwarding
When forwarding an email in Gmail you can remove the attachments by either using the reply option instead of the forward option or by deleting the attachments before forwarding the email.
1 – Open the email that you would like to forward.
2 – Click on the forward button at the end of the email or in the drop-down menu at the top right of the email.

3 – Within the email forwarding window, scroll down to the end of the original message and locate the attachments, then click on the “x” to the right of the attachment names to remove them.

4 – Enter the email address of the person that you’re forwarding the email to and click send to forward the email without the attachments.
5 – How To Delete Forwarded Email In Gmail
In Gmail, you can delete individual conversations of a forwarded email by using the built-in delete message feature.
1 – Open the forwarded email.
2 – Within the conversation thread of this email locate the specific correspondence that you would like to delete.

3 – Once located click on the email thread then click on the three vertical dots to the upper right of that specific email message.

4 – In the dropdown menu select the “delete this message” option to remove that specific email message.
